Nightmare

by Willo Davis Roberts

Age rating: Ages 14–16 · Teens

Age rating and Christian content guidance for parents.

First published 1989

A young girl is sent to live with relatives after a traumatic event, where she experiences unsettling occurrences and uncovers a mystery.
